Private jet charter from Atlanta to San Juan

The route from Atlanta (PDK) to San Juan (SJU) covers approximately 2,498 km, about 4h 40m nonstop by private jet.

We did not observe a regular nonstop pattern between Atlanta and San Juan over the last 12 months, so this sector is normally flown ad hoc. Departure-end activity is solid though: 17,844 business aircraft movements were tracked at Atlanta, around 1,487 a month.

Aircraft based at or passing through Atlanta are led by the Embraer Phenom 300 and the Pilatus PC-12, with an average build year of 2012 — that is the pool a charter for this route is most likely to come from.

At the arrival end, San Juan recorded 1,679 tracked movements over the same period (about 140 a month), most often the Pilatus PC-12.

Departures from Atlanta are weekday-led (63% of movements Monday to Thursday) — the classic sign of a business field, where weekend positioning is often available at short notice.
